Synopsis

HIGHLY COMMENDED BY THE WEEK JUNIOR BOOK AWARDS

'Forget Sherlock Holmes - this dog detective will have children in suspense [...] A clever pastiche of classic detective fiction' - The Telegraph 5* review

An adorable new highly-illustrated series bursting with mystery and mischief for readers aged 5+!

Watts doesn't think he's got what it takes to be a great detective like his parents. So when they jet off on their next case, he decides to take a holiday to Whiskerton Manor instead.

But there, Watts befriends Pearl Whiskerton, a curious cat with a nose for mysteries, who persuades him to help her investigate a series of strange goings on at the manor . . .

Who's been upending the precious rose bushes? And where did the amazing dinosaur bones dug up on the grounds come from?

It looks like the two things might be connected. But can this dog and cat detective duo solve the mystery?

From Waterstones Children's Book Prize shortlisted author-illustrator Meg McLaren, WATTS & WHISKERTON is purr-fect for emerging readers and fans of CLAUDE, HOTEL FLAMINGO and RABBIT & BEAR.
